Data tokenization plays a crucial role in securing sensitive information while maintaining system performance. It ensures that critical data—like personal identifiable information (PII) or payment card details—is never stored or transmitted in its raw form. Modern applications often require seamless integrations across services, making tokenized systems a cornerstone for secure, efficient infrastructure access.
This begs the question: how do you implement a reliable data tokenization infrastructure that doesn’t compromise speed, accessibility, or scalability? Let’s break that down.
What is Data Tokenization?
Data tokenization is the process of replacing sensitive data with unique, randomly generated tokens. These tokens carry no usable value or meaning outside the system where they are issued. The sensitive data itself is securely stored in a vault and accessed only through strict authorization workflows.
For example, when a user submits credit card details during checkout, a token is issued to represent the card number. This token is then used across subsequent operations (logging, analytics, transaction processing) instead of the original details, ensuring zero exposure of raw data.
By separating the tokenized data and raw data storage, systems gain an added layer of protection against data breaches.
Why Data Tokenization Infrastructure Matters
1. Enhanced Security Posture
The most apparent advantage of data tokenization is security. By removing sensitive information from operational workflows, you minimize the attack surface. Hackers may breach a system, but they won’t find usable data. Even if tokens are leaked, they are meaningless without the associated vault.
Furthermore, tokenization can help maintain compliance with regulations like GDPR, PCI DSS, and HIPAA, where safeguarding personal and financial data is mandatory.
2. Scalability Without Trade-offs
As applications grow, managing sensitive data across various services can introduce bottlenecks or demand excessive resources. Tokenization eliminates these complexities. Tokens are lightweight and interchangeable across systems, enabling engineers to scale services without micromanaging secure data flows.
Tokenization infrastructure also works well with cloud-native architecture. Integrating tokenization logic into API gateways, microservices, or even serverless functions is straightforward—provided the infrastructure is designed for modular, distributed systems.
3. Infrastructure Integration
Working with tokenized data doesn’t have to obstruct developer productivity. A well-designed system should bolt onto your existing pipelines or workflows. Developers can access tokenized data seamlessly through APIs, SDKs, or custom middleware, sparing them from reinventing security patterns repeatedly.
Additionally, tokenization avoids distributed duplication of sensitive information. Clear separation policies ensure that sensitive data remains in its vault, while tokens enable developers to work unencumbered on other parts of the system.
Common Challenges in Data Tokenization Access
While tokenization addresses core security issues, the implementation isn’t without its challenges:
- Performance Bottlenecks: Tokenization infrastructure systems can slow down applications if not optimized for high-throughput or low latency.
- Integration Complexity: Retrofitting existing systems with tokenization might lead to engineering friction unless the solution is flexible and modular.
- Key Management: Without robust processes for managing encryption keys and token vaults, the entire system could be compromised.
These challenges highlight the need for an efficient, accessible, and developer-friendly tokenization infrastructure.
How to Implement Effective Tokenization Infrastructure Access
1. Set Clear Guidelines
Define the scope of tokenization early. Decide which types of sensitive data—payment details, PII, healthcare records—require tokenization. Building clear policies ensures a consistent implementation across diverse applications and teams.
2. Prioritize Robust Key Management
Tokens rely on encryption and hashing mechanisms, making key management the foundation of strong tokenization. Invest in automated key rotation, tiered access levels, and secure key storage.
3. Choose Scalable APIs
Your tokenization infrastructure should provide APIs that can handle the intended volume of requests. These services should support both synchronous workflows (e.g., token generation during user inputs) and asynchronous processes (e.g., bulk token generation for analytics pipelines).
4. Centralize the Token Vault
Tokens are as secure as the environment where original data resides. Utilize a centralized vault that offers fine-grained access controls, role-based permissions, and audit logging.
5. Seamlessly Integrate With CI/CD Pipelines
Modern engineering emphasizes fast iteration cycles, and tokenization pipelines must align with this philosophy. Ensure tokenization components are easily configurable and tested across deployment environments.
A successful tokenization infrastructure shouldn’t only be secure; it should also accelerate developer productivity. Tools designed with engineers in mind minimize technical debt and remove adoption friction. Security-first solutions that integrate into your stack save time without sacrificing defense.
Whether you’re modernizing legacy systems or working in an agile, cloud-native environment, implementing tokenization infrastructure doesn’t need to feel like a sprawling task. When supported with intuitive tooling, robust APIs, and seamless onboarding, token-based architectures become an essential building block of scalable, secure systems.
Streamline your infrastructure with Hoop.dev’s developer-first tokenization solution. See it live in minutes—effortless integration and security-first design come together to make tokenization intuitive for engineers and scalable for organizations. Speed up your workflows today!